Recognizing Dental Emergency Situations



If your child experiences serious tooth pain or a knocked-out tooth, these are indicators of oral emergency situations that require prompt focus. Tooth pain that's sharp, persistent, or accompanied by swelling could indicate an infection or an abscess, which requires timely care from a dental professional.

Additionally, a knocked-out tooth, whether because of a loss or a crash, is another important situation where fast activity is important for prospective re-implantation.

Other signs of oral emergencies in children include bleeding that doesn't quit after using stress, a cracked or fractured tooth, or a loosened tooth because of injury. Any type of injury to the mouth that causes extreme bleeding, swelling, or serious discomfort shouldn't be overlooked and requires immediate assessment by a dental specialist.

Being able to identify these indicators early and seeking timely intervention can aid prevent better issues and make sure the very best feasible outcome for your child's dental wellness.

Immediate Emergency Treatment Steps



In cases of oral emergency situations in youngsters, promptly using emergency treatment steps can help relieve pain and reduce prospective issues.

If your kid experiences a knocked-out tooth, carefully wash it with water, taking care not to touch the root, and try to reinsert it right into the outlet. If this isn't possible, keep the tooth in a glass of milk or saliva and look for instant dental care.

For a fractured or damaged tooth, wash the mouth with warm water and use a cold compress to decrease swelling.

In situations involving a bitten tongue or lip, use pressure with a clean fabric to stop any blood loss and use a chilly compress to decrease swelling.
